This episode explores the idea that many classroom misbehaviors are really skill gaps—like impulse control or task initiation—rather than character flaws. It also breaks down a practical Preview-Warning-Consequence framework for teaching replacement skills in the moment, plus an AI prompt to generate customized responses fast.
